Transaction 521500f989b51ff865e66751b7e1fa217ffc149029f72b4b92ebb6484db0bc8d

1 Input
2 Outputs
  • 521500f989b51ff865e66751b7e1fa217ffc149029f72b4b92ebb6484db0bc8d:0
  • value  468990
    address  1BizSWfivXAgYmFcxEzodpew543YoqWgxj
  • 521500f989b51ff865e66751b7e1fa217ffc149029f72b4b92ebb6484db0bc8d:1
  • value  14065875
    address  14mzRYaY78fptbpkbgRJL9jygWbvWKQDq9